View Top Employees for The Fife Arms
img Website thefifearms.com
img Industry Hospitality
img Location Braemar, Aberdeenshire, United Kingdom
img Employees 33
img Website thefifearms.com
img Industry Hospitality
img Location Braemar, Aberdeenshire, United Kingdom
img Employees 33
img LinkedIn linkedin.com/company/the-fife-arms

Top The Fife Arms Employees